Difference between Bulgy and Protrusive

What is the difference between Bulgy and Protrusive?

Bulgy as an adjective is having one or more bulges; bulging while Protrusive as an adjective is that protrudes; protruding

Bulgy

Part of speech: adjective

Definition: Having one or more bulges; bulging

Protrusive

Part of speech: adjective

Definition: that protrudes; protrudingrather conspicuous; obtrusive
